Mipmapping Mipmapping is a technique to improve graphics performance by generating and storing multiple versions of the original texture image, each with different levels of detail. The graphics processor chooses a different mipmap based on how large the object is on the screen, so that low-detail textures can be used on objects that contain only a few pixels and high-detail textures can be used on larger objects where the user will actually see the difference.
